Hi everyone,

I'm encountering an issue with OpenStudio 3.7.0 where default Output:Meter are (I suppose) added by default to the model just before simulation starts, despite my attempts to disable them using a custom measure. Specifically, I'm interested in suppressing these meters from appearing in the "timestep" frequency report (Electricity:Facility, NaturalGas:Facility, DistrictCooling:Facility, etc.)

If I'm not wrong, I think this is a default behavior by OpenStudio, but we are working with huge URBANopt models and this kind of timestep outputs are so time and resources consuming when applied to an urban area simulation.

Could someone please advise if there's a method or workaround to achieve this? Any insights or alternative approaches would be greatly appreciated.

Thanks!
